To each their own, but if you're comparing a loaded GT or GT500 that's it right there. You want more of the creature comforts. I myself wanted something that's all business and I've always preferred road racing over drag racing. not that I don't dig drag racing also. I bought a base 2011 GT with brembos & 3.73's and nothing else. It was a great car with good power and handled well. My Boss blows it away in the handling department and being able to rev to 7500rpm pulling all the way to redline is just sick. I did the Track Attack at MMP and let me tell you the cars just ripped the track up. Riding shotgun with a pro driver was a real eye opener on just how capable the cars are. He was probably only driving 70% of his ability to top it off. On the street you can't push the car anywhere near what it is capable of. Someone really let you smash on their Boss and you were disappointed huh? That's hard to believe. I won't let anybody drive mine! No doubt the tip in torque on a GT500 will pin you in the seat, but a high revving NA engine has it's own appeal. Apples to oranges.

quote: Originally posted by Cobra 93-4992: Besides the graphics and awesome looking appearance package. What else does it have vs a normal 302?
It has 32 more horsepower from ported and polished cylinder heads and the Boss intake. All the internals are forged. You get an upgraded clutch and flywheel. The suspension is dramatically improved (different springs, sway bars, etc.) and uses 5 way adjustable shocks. The Boss has unique exhaust that features an additional pair of side exits ahead of the rear wheels. One of the coolest things is the TracKey. It changes roughly 400 engine management/vehicle parameters and includes a launch control feature, pit lane speed limiter, and a lopey idle. A few people have dyno'd with and without the TracKey and are showing just over 20 hp gains. You can also opt for the sweet Recaro buckets seats and Torsen diff. I did.
I think that covers most of the major stuff but there are definitely more obvious things like the wheels and stickier rubber. Also, Ford is only building about 3250 "standard" Boss 302's and just over 750 Laguna Seca editions for 2012. [ December 20, 2011, 08:09 PM: Message edited by: iceman302 ]
